> > > > > > This reverts commit b26a6b35581c84124bd78b68cc02d171fbd572c9.
> > > > > > 
> > > > > > commit b26a6b35581c ("drm/i915: Make prepare_plane_fb fully
> > > > > > interruptible.")
> > > > > > breaks GPU reset on gen3/4 machines. Go back to to non
> > > > > > -interruptible.
> > > > > > 
> > > > > I've done some digging and by forcing an unconditional modeset during
> > > > > reset I was able to trigger it on my system.
> > > > Hmm, maybe we should add some kind of debug knob to do just that. That
> > > > way we could test most of the gen3/4 reset path with gen5+.
> > > > 
> > > > I thought we already had that for load detection, but I may have
> > > > imagined it considering that load detection seems to have been 
> > > > broken now for a while.
> > > We still have it for load detect, including an igt. No one looks at igt
> > > results though :(
> > > 
> > > Maarten, can you please take care of both of these before pushing more
> > > atomic work? And I guess that means that we should apply the revert first.
> > > So Acked-by: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ch> on the revert.
> > > 
> > > Cheers, Daniel
> > > 
> > Reset is already fixed upstream so reverting wont help.
> 
> Sorry, I missed that the patch landed already.
> 
> > What igt is used for load detection then?
> 
> We're missing it it seems. Iirc Ander was working on it, but only the
> debugfs part to force-enable load-detect logic was merged into the kernel.
